胜蓝科技

云服务器是固件还是软件?与硬件的区别解析

日期:2025-03-06 00:00 / 作者:网络

一、云服务器的定义与本质属性

云服务器是基于云计算技术的虚拟化服务,其本质是通过虚拟化技术将物理硬件资源抽象为可动态分配的逻辑资源池,用户通过网络按需获取计算、存储和网络服务。与固件软件不同,云服务器属于服务层(IaaS)的范畴,既依赖底层硬件支撑,又需要通过虚拟化软件实现资源管理。

二、云服务器与固件的区别

固件是嵌入硬件设备的底层程序,用于控制硬件基本功能(如主板BIOS),而云服务器则表现为以下差异:

  • 功能层级:固件属于硬件控制层,云服务器属于资源服务层
  • 交互方式:固件通过物理接口与硬件通信,云服务器通过网络协议提供服务
  • 更新机制:固件需手动刷写,云服务器资源可动态调整

三、云服务器与软件的关系

云服务器与软件存在协同关系但属性不同:

  1. 软件是运行在操作系统上的程序集合,而云服务器提供承载软件的虚拟化环境
  2. 虚拟化软件(如KVM、VMware)是云服务器实现资源分割的核心工具
  3. 用户通过软件接口管理云服务器资源,但服务本身不属于软件产品

四、云服务器与硬件服务器的对比

表1:核心差异对比
维度 云服务器 硬件服务器
资源分配 虚拟化动态分配 物理资源独占
扩展能力 分钟级弹性伸缩 需硬件升级
故障恢复 跨节点自动迁移 依赖人工维护

五、技术实现原理

云服务器的运行架构包含三个核心要素:

  • 虚拟化层:通过Hypervisor实现物理资源分割
  • 分布式架构:跨多台物理机构建资源池
  • 服务编排:API驱动资源配置自动化

云服务器既非固件也非传统软件,而是依托硬件基础设施、通过虚拟化软件实现的资源服务形态。其与硬件服务器的核心区别在于资源分配模式和服务交付方式,具有弹性扩展、高可用性等技术特征。


# 和服务  # intr_t  # png  # fanw  # tubiao  # intr_b  # dianxin  # 是基于  # 其本质  # 既非  # 固件  # 资源管理  # 按需  # 基础设施  # 多台  # 表现为  # 不属于  # 资源配置  # 可用性  # 动态分配